Cephalon Sithalo Feb 5, 2019 @ 7:52pm 
It doesnt bug out the tileset but it does bug out the city set.

I solved your problem though.

You need to go into your 00_portraits_main and add vanillas #L06 city code else the game is missing some of its code so it just shows the normal city and since you cannot see the ground see the ground on a city world they didnt bother giving it a ground so its just a bunch of pale pale flat blue.

I added the code to test it and it works proper with that little bit :LotusFlower:
